Complete work
- Editor: John Kilpatrick (submitted 2009-11-30). Score information: A4, 138 pages, 1.48 MB Copyright: Public Domain
- Edition notes: Complete performing edition including 7-part Magnificat but excluding 6-part alternative. Edition based on the 1610 part-books but in modern clefs and notation; barring by the editor, not taken from other editions. Continuo realization included (Monteverdi's bass plus mainly chordal right-hand; continuo requires organ; optional harpsichord suggestions given in short-score; some bassus generalis passages are also given to cello 1 or 2 or to trombone 3). Instrumental parts included for all the psalms. Lauda & Magnificat transposed down a 4th from apparent pitch. Opening intonation included. No antiphons included.
- Available scores & parts: Vocal Score (140 pages including covers), full Score in two parts (nos. 1-10, 144 pages; nos. 11-13, 60 pages), parts for 12 instruments (11 to 16 pages per part), short score for continuo use (100 pages including covers). Words & translation also available for inclusion in vocal scores or programmes (4 pages, reducible to A5).

General Information
Title: Vespro della Beata Vergine (Vespers of 1610)
Composer: Claudio Monteverdi
Number of voices: 8vv Voicing: SSAATTBB
Genre: Sacred, Motet, Vespers
Language: Latin
Instruments: Mixed ensemble
- cornetts 1 & 2 (or D trumpets) • cornett 3 (or B flat cornet/trumpet) • trombones 1 & 2 • trombone 3 (Bass in F; or bass in G if low C played in falsett) • violins 1 & 2 • violas 1 & 2 • cellos 1 & 2 • organ and optionally other continuo • recorders 1 & 2 (short passages ideally played by other instrumentalists or singers)
Published: Messa e Vespro della Beata Vergine, 1610
